Search Add 2 Amandus Ivanschiz Amandus Ivančič Amandus Ivančič (fl. mid-18th-century) was a Slovenian composer. Little is known about him, save that he appears to have been active in Austria and in the present-day Czech Republic and Slovakia. According to New Grove, in 1758, he was a Pauline monk in the Maria-Trost monastery near Graz. There are several variant spellings of his surname (Ivanschitz; Ivanschicz; Ivancsics; Ivanschütz; Ivantzitz; Ivanczitz). He wrote sonatas for flute, viola, and basso continuo as well as symphonies.

Search Add 2 Эдуард Сепашвили ედუარდ სეფაშვილი Eduard Sepashvili (1928-2004) was a Georgian singer and guitarist. Active since 1953, he sang in a vocal trios with Marekh Godziashvili ([a9121453]) and Konstantine Makaridze ([a3578230]), then with Giuli Chokheli ([a716077]) & Soso Ebralidze ([a2747383]), then in 1958 with Venera Maisuradze ([a2019215]) and Vakhtang Norakidze ([a9127657]). He formed and led the vocal-instrumental trio Lale ([a2997416]) from 1960 to 1970. In 1981 he formed another trio - Shashvebi ([a3578233]) with Guram Balarjishvili ([a3578232]) & Konstantine Makaridze ([a3578230]). In 1998 he formed the trio "სეფას ბიჭები" (Sepas Bichebi), and led it for the rest of his life. He was the father of [a3115843].

Search Add 2 Elitni Odredi Elitni Odredi (Serbian Cyrillic: Елитни Одреди, English: Elite Units) is an ex Serbian hip-hop and R'n'B group from Belgrade, formed in 2005. The group consisted of two members and a long-time friends, Relja Popović known as Drima and Vladimir Matović known as Wonta. The group was formed in 2005 with first singles released including "Ako Ste Za Rakiju", "Biće Ekstra", "Sale" and others. In 2006., with the release of the single "Moja Jedina" the group gained wide fame across Serbia and other former Yugoslav countries. They released their first studio album called "Oko Sveta" (English: Around The World) in 2010. and also claimed success with songs "Raj", "Džek i Čivas", "Ljubav i Milion Dolara" and "Samo Da Si Sa Mnom". This album also marked their switch from rap to more R'n'B orientated type of music. In January 2015., media started to write that Relja's girlfriend, singer [a=Nikolija Jovanović], [a=Vesna Zmijanac]'s daughter, is pregnant. Relja and Nikolija confirmed it. Soon after that, media also started to write that Elitni Odredi has fallen apart because of Nikolija. They confirmed it in the show called Exkluziv at Prva Srpska Televizija.

Search Add 2 Trío Evocación Guanajay has always been prodigal as far as artists are concerned, without genre limitations. Some more known, others less remembered, had an unquestionable quality that made them popular beyond the limits of the land that saw them born. Such is the case of the Trío Evocación, which emerged in the middle of the 20th century. His first public presentation was in 1953 in a show presented at the Spanish Colony, because of the carnival festivities and was composed of José A. Crespo Victores (voice premium, maracas, guayo), Juan Luis Arango (second voice and guitar) and Jorge Delgado (third voice and requinto). A year later they appeared on the television program Escuela de Televisión, directed by Gaspar Pumarejo with a samba sung in Portuguese. The program promoted amateur artists of recognized quality, who competed and, in addition, shared the stage with other Cuban and foreign professionals. On this occasion the Trío Evocación was awarded the Special Jury Prize and the invitation to remain in the space for a long period of time that served as a true school of instruction and experience. Application to be professionals In 1956, the Trio made a request to the Cuban Association of Theatrical Artists, being accepted to appear before the Examining Court in charge of approving the artistic capacity of the applicants, being accepted as professionals that same year. Important nightclubs in the capital witnessed the musical work of the Evocation Trio, which alternated with well-known artists, among them the Spanish Sara Montiel and the Chilean Lucho Gatica, when he visited our country for the first time. Apart from their nightly performances, they kept a fixed program for a year, every Sunday, at 4:00 pm on the "La voz del Aire" station. Founding member of the Trío, José A. Crespo still resides in Guanajay. A man passionate to music, a hobby that he recognizes motivated by his cousin, the soprano América Crespo, another great artist from Guanajuato, of whom little is spoken, with an exquisite voice who will walk the name of Cuba in important halls of the world. This simple man confesses with modesty to have composed forty musical pieces, which are inscribed in the Registry of the Association of Authors and many of them have been and are interpreted by recognized groups. Although in 1966 the Trio was dissolved, he decided to follow the path of music, without abandoning his job as Head of Production and Sales in the Tannery of the town that today bears the name of José Ramón Martínez, in which he remained for thirty and three years, and is incorporated as a singer in the professional group of Digno González. When the famous artists' evaluations began in the seventies, they suggested that in order to remain professional, they should leave their other work; He did not understand it that way and he definitely left the song, but he continues composing. Later he won two prizes in the Provincial Contest of the Creator, with the bolero There will not be a penalty of love, defended by the orchestra Cubaney and the guaracha You say that there is no rumba, performed by the Benny Moré orchestra, respectively. In his thirteen years of struggling the Trio Evocación always maintained a repertoire full of cuban and professionalism.
